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30543 84169194 8139 5587
32569349307 5518
32569349307 5518
305 57705 97373095 08173206 12696
All about undefined
Interested in learning more?
32569349307 5518
305 57705 97373095 08173206 12696
See more
38 75
4613824 1118 6393 436 81
See more
1675 902651492
548277798 40 35154
See more